RetroVirox offers a menu of cell-based antiviral services to evaluate experimental therapies and vaccines against coronaviruses, including SARS-CoV-2. The company offers in vitro testing with SARS-CoV-2 pseudovirions and with  live SARS-CoV-2 viruses to evaluate entry inhibitors, neutralizing antibodies, and antivirals against the novel coronavirus causative agent of COVID-19. Multiple viral strains are available for testing, including the most recent Omicron variants of concern (XBB.1.5, XBB.1.16, XBB.2.3.2, EG.5.1 JN.1, KP.2, and KP.3).

 

Pseudoviruses  coated with the viral spike (S) protein of SARS-CoV-2 are also used to recapitulate the mode of entry of the novel coronavirus. Over 50 spike mutant and variants are available as pseudoviruses. These assays can be used for the following purposes:

 

  • To determine the neutralizing activity of therapeutic antibodies and antisera
  • To test experimental COVID-19 vaccines using antisera from inoculated animals or humans
  • To evaluate small-molecule and other entry inhibitors targeting the S viral protein, the ACE-2 viral receptor, or host proteases and other targets involved in SARS-CoV-2 viral entry

 

Assays with live replicating SARS-CoV-2, and milder forms of seasonal human coronaviruses (hCoV-OC43  and 229E) allow for the evaluation of inhibitors at all stages of the coronavirus life cycle. Additional Information about the coronavirus assays and many other cell-based antiviral assays offered at RetroVirox is available here.
